My Fave!
Love the hold of this glue. It's my favorite. And I've tried plenty!! I'm 59 years old and I still have severe hot flashes. Meaning I sweat! I shower, shampoo, as normal. Condition, just the ends of my hair and executions. Trying not to get product on the attached area,, where the glue is.. (of course) I've never have had need to worry when swimming in pool or ocean. When an extension is ready to be reattached, it loosens first.. Giving you enough time to troubleshoot, the issue. Or- to follow through with the complete reattachment of the loose weft. The process can be bit messy. Always keep the brush over the open jar, as it drips. Using less product on the brush., makes it easier to manage. And less waste. Just add more applicatiin of product as needed, before placing to your scalp. Also, make sure the cap is on-tight! I always smear the rings of the bottle opening with baby oil or Vaseline. It will help the seal. And will be easier to open and close, when it's time for your next use. I wish you well! ♡

Can't get anything out of the bottle!
In my experience with this particular product the blotter filter on the tip of the bottle is SO thick as to make it impossible to get anything out of the bottle. I understand you have to tap tap tap the applicator on your head to get a little bond protector fluid out of the bottle, but this was not possible with this product. I even punched tiny holes in the top of the applicator in hopes of making it 'breathe' and creating some airflow so the bond liquid would release. No luck. I suppose I could hack the top of the bottle off and use a Q tip to apply the protector. But this isn't ideal.
